The Cub Cadet ULTIMA Series ZT1 50 features a 23 HP Kawasaki FR691V series Twin-cylinder OHV Engine, 2 in. x 2 in. tubular steel frame, comfortable high back seat and much more. The Ultima Zero-Turn Riding Mower was built to raise the bar for enhanced strength, durability, redefined comfort and uncompromised performance.
- Premium 23 HP 726 cc Kawasaki FR691V twin-cylinder OHV engine, commercial-grade power plant that meets your yards toughest demands
- Dual hydrostatic transmissions dual hydro-gear EZT-2200 dual hydrostatic rear-wheel transmission for quick and effortless 7. 5 MPH forward and 3. 5 MPH reverse zero-turn controlled ground speeds, that quickly leaves your lawn with a professional-quality finish
- Tough and tubular frame the high-strength, continuous square 2 in. x 2 in. tubular steel frame with fully e-coat lower frame and triple guard corrosion defense system, a multi-step process electronically applies automotive-grade corrosion resistance with meticulous care to protect against wear and tear
- Equipped with an 11-Gauge 50 in. fabricated triple-blade Aeroforce Deck (high lift) deck with reinforced leading edges that results in finer clippings, fewer clumps, reduced stragglers and increased evenness, protected by the Cub Cadet triple guard corrosion defense system with e-coat and a lifetime warranty
- Dial in your perfect cut with a foot operated deck lift and a dial control knob offering 15 qt. in. deck height adjustments from 1 in. to 4. 5 in. leading to a precise and even cut
- High comfort, high performance an automotive-inspired, ergonomic, fully adjustable premium 18 in. H-back seat and a durable, advanced polymer seat suspension system, adjustable lap bars and industry-exclusive ergonomic hand grips optimized for comfort providing you the confidence to maximize your speed and reduce operator fatigue
- Turf damage prevention 11 in. x 6 in. to 5 in. smooth tread front wheels pivot 180 without turf damage, 20 in. x 10 in. to 8 in. turf master premium rear tires offer excellent traction, minimize turfing and provide a better ride on uneven ground at higher speeds
- Ease of maintenance an open frame design and hinged/removable floor pan allow easy access to the deck and engine for quick and simple maintenance
- Command center conveniently located control panel enhances operator productivity and vibration-dampening soft rubber floor mat provides sure footing, comfort and ample leg room
- Precision trimming offset front casters align with blade edge for trimming precision while maintaining line-of-sight and stable balance
- Illuminating dual-LED headlights provide ultimate vision for mowing in low light conditions and tow hitch come standard
- Mow for an extended period of time: 3. 5 Gal. fuel tank capacity to keep you mowing and minimize time loss for refueling needs
- Electronic fingertip blade engagement PTO allows for smooth operation of the deck
- 3-way adjustable ergonomic lap bar design with integrated parking brake and mow-in-reverse, provides comfort with a simple operation
- Ideal for mowing slight rolling hills and several obstacles up to 4 acres
- Expand your movers capabilities: full lineup of premium attachments and accessories include baggers, mulch kits, carts and many other attachments (sold separately)
- Cub Cadet Ultima ZT1-50 comes fully crated and requires some assembly upon arrival

This thing is a beast. An absolute monster. It does not *care* what it mows. Seriously. My granddaughter left her scooter on the ground and I didn’t see it in time. “Sorry sweetie” We gave it a good burial. My previous mower was a Craftsman 42″ 21HP riding lawn mower. It could never handle our lawn. Would constantly bog down on the first mow of the season. Wet grass would get stuck inside and I’d have to stop after every pass, shut the thing down and manually clean the wet grass out of the mower blades. It finally died after chewing up the starter and I figured 2 years was the most I was getting out of the thing. I wasn’t going back to Sears obviously, so I started looking at Cub Cadet and ended up on the ZT1. The ZT1 is head and shoulders above the Craftsman. Heck, it’s six FEET above the Craftsman. It had no problem handling the first mow of the season. Wet grass? It laughed at it! Broken branch? Don’t care. Granddaughter’s scooter? I heard a weird noise and stopped and went back to look; well, see the pic. It would’ve killed the Craftsman. I just moved the wreckage out of the way and went on with my mowing. OK, so here’s some Cons: Remember I said our yard is full of gopher holes? The ZT1 drives over them no problem but it’s a serious bounce-fest. Very uncomfortable ride. I wouldn’t put a beer in the cup holder – I’d be wearing the beer by the end. Whoever assembled this at the factory decided to put the nuts on the inside of the drive handles, where my legs and knees rub against when I’m being bounced around our yard. Needless to say, after the third scratch actually drew blood, I did a quick fix. Just turned the bolts around to the other side. Definitely a learning curve driving the thing. I got stuck a few times before I realized I shouldn’t BACK out, I should just 360 and DRIVE out. Worked much better once I realized that. Now the question is, how long will it last? I paid $1500 for the Craftsman, just about double for the ZT1. If the ZT1 lasts four years it will be worth it! I hope it lasts longer…
